In what ways can companies leverage data analytics to measure the ROI of their continuous learning and development programs in preparing employees for the future of work?

Companies can leverage data analytics to measure the ROI of their continuous learning and development programs by tracking key performance indicators such as employee engagement, productivity, and retention rates before and after implementing the programs. They can also analyze data on employee skill development and performance improvements to assess the impact of the programs on individual and team outcomes. Additionally, companies can use data analytics to identify trends and patterns in learning behaviors and outcomes, allowing them to make data-driven decisions on future program investments and adjustments. By leveraging data analytics, companies can gain valuable insights into the effectiveness of their continuous learning and development programs in preparing employees for the future of work and make informed decisions to optimize their impact.
